The agreement is based on Acorn's new thin-client terminal reference design, DeskLite(TM). This further strengthens the Acorn/Boca strategic partnership, first announced in October 1997, for the development, design, manufacture and sale of set-top Internet access and thin-client/server computing devices. Acorn Group Acorn Group, based in Cambridge, U.K., is a technology design company with a strong market focus on Digital interactive TV (DiTV) and Information Appliances (IA). Acorn offers world-class capabilities in complete product, silicon, operating systems and software component design. Acorn solutions provide high levels of functionality, the flexibility that only software can provide, and a reduced component count. Acorn's status as an independent design company allows its innovative technologies to be applied in a range of applications across the consumer electronics industry. BocaVision dial-up and LAN-based ICA clients lower total cost of ownership and improve systems administration for thin-client/server computing. In combining network (Internet) access and access to Windows applications, the BocaVision client is ideally suited for the emerging subscription-based computing market. About Thinergy '98 Thinergy '98, the first global conference on thin-client/server computing, is held in Orlando, Fla. Sept. 1-3. Hosted by Citrix, thinergy will educate end-users, resellers and integrators about developing and deploying solutions, applications and devices for a server-based computing architecture.
